A geotechnical engineer is a specialized civil engineer that focuses on the actions of dirt, rock, and other products found under the Planet's surface. They apply scientific concepts and design methods to analyze the residential or commercial properties and habits of these materials to sustain the secure and efficient design, building, and upkeep of infrastructure projects.


They conduct site investigations, collect examples, do research laboratory tests, and examine information to assess the suitability of the ground for building tasks - Geotechnical Engineers. Based on their findings, geotechnical engineers supply recommendations for foundation layout, incline security, maintaining frameworks, and reduction of geotechnical hazards. They collaborate with various other experts, such as engineers, architectural engineers, and building and construction groups, to make certain that geotechnical considerations are integrated right into the total project design and application


By examining the behavior and properties of dirt and rock, they can determine possible geotechnical threats such as landslides, dirt negotiation, or incline instability. Their proficiency aids stop failings or accidents that could endanger lives and building. Below are some comprehensive obligations and responsibilities of a geotechnical designer: Site Investigation: Geotechnical designers conduct website investigations to gather information on subsurface conditions.




They analyze the information to recognize the buildings and actions of the soil and rock, including their toughness, permeability, compaction qualities, and groundwater conditions. Geotechnical Evaluation and Style: Geotechnical engineers evaluate the information collected during website investigations to assess the security and suitability of the website for building jobs. They do geotechnical computations and modeling to assess factors such as birthing capacity, settlement, incline security, lateral earth pressures, and groundwater circulation.

Foundation Style: Geotechnical designers play an important function in developing foundations that can safely sustain the desired structure. They evaluate the soil conditions and lots needs to determine the ideal structure kind, such as superficial foundations (e.g., footings), deep foundations (e.g (https://www.tumblr.com/geotheta/757702666915840000/geotheta-has-grown-exponentially-since?source=share)., piles), or specialized strategies like soil enhancement. They consider aspects such as settlement limitations, bearing capability, and soil-structure communication to establish optimum foundation layouts


They examine building strategies, monitor website tasks, and conduct area evaluations to confirm that the style referrals are adhered to. If unexpected geotechnical concerns develop, they evaluate the situation and provide suggestions for removal or modifications to the layout. Danger Assessment and Reduction: Geotechnical designers assess geotechnical hazards and risks linked with the job website, such as landslides, liquefaction, or dirt erosion.

This might involve recommending incline stablizing approaches, drainage systems, or soil improvement methods to lessen the prospective effect of geotechnical risks. Record Composing and Paperwork: Geotechnical engineers prepare detailed reports documenting their searchings for, evaluations, and suggestions - https://www.pageorama.com/?p=geotheta. These records are vital for communicating info to task stakeholders, consisting of architects, architectural engineers, specialists, and governing authorities


Cooperation and Communication: Geotechnical designers work closely with other specialists entailed in a task, such as architects, structural designers, and building and construction teams. Reliable communication and partnership are necessary to incorporate geotechnical factors to consider right into the total job layout and building procedure. Geotechnical engineers offer technological knowledge, solution questions, and make sure that geotechnical demands are fulfilled.

Below are some sorts of geotechnical designers: Structure Designer: Structure engineers focus on designing and examining foundations for frameworks. They assess the dirt problems, lots demands, and site attributes to determine one of the most proper foundation kind and layout, such as shallow foundations, deep structures, or specialized techniques like stack foundations.


They examine the aspects influencing slope security, such as soil residential or commercial properties, groundwater problems, and slope geometry, and develop approaches to avoid incline failures and reduce threats. Quake Engineer: Quake designers specialize in evaluating and designing frameworks to stand up to seismic forces. They examine the seismic risk of a site, evaluate soil liquefaction possibility, and develop seismic design criteria to guarantee the safety and security and strength of structures during quakes.


They execute area screening, gather examples, and analyze the collected information to identify the dirt homes, geologic formations, and groundwater problems at a website. Geotechnical Instrumentation Designer: Geotechnical instrumentation engineers concentrate on surveillance and determining the behavior of dirt, rock, and structures. They mount and keep instrumentation systems that check variables such as soil settlement, groundwater degrees, slope activities, and architectural displacements to analyze performance and supply very early cautions of possible problems.

They carry out tests such as triaxial tests, combination tests, straight shear tests, and leaks in the structure examinations to gather information for geotechnical evaluation and layout. Geosynthetics Designer: Geosynthetics designers focus on the style and application of geosynthetic materials, such as geotextiles, geogrids, and geomembranes. They use these products to enhance dirt security, reinforce slopes, offer drain options, and control erosion.

In the office my latest blog post environment, geotechnical designers utilize specialized software program tools to do computations, develop designs, and assess information. They prepare records, testimonial job requirements, connect with clients and team members, and coordinate job tasks. The workplace setup supplies a helpful environment for research study, analysis, and cooperation with various other experts associated with the task.

They frequently visit task sites to carry out site investigations, assess geotechnical conditions, and collect information for evaluation. These gos to involve traveling to various areas, sometimes in remote or challenging terrains. Geotechnical designers might carry out soil sampling, conduct examinations, and screen building tasks to guarantee that the geotechnical facets of the task are being executed appropriately.


Geotechnical engineers additionally operate in specialized geotechnical research laboratories. In these facilities, they perform experiments, do examinations on dirt and rock samples, and examine the design buildings of the materials. Geotechnical lab engineers work extensively in these atmospheres, managing testing devices, running instruments, and tape-recording information. They collaborate with various other laboratory team to make certain exact and reputable testing results.
